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ith concentrates on offering services related to car locks, including lockouts, key duplications, and reprogramming. These specialists are equipped with the knowledge and tools to deal with different types of car locks and security systems. Whether you require to open your car, replace a lost key, or install a brand-new security system, a car locksmith can help you.

What to Look for in a Car Locksmith
When picking a car locksmith, consider the list below factors to ensure you get a trusted and affordable service:
- Experience: An experienced locksmith is more most likely to handle your issue effectively and with very little damage to your vehicle.
- Accreditations: Look for locksmith professionals who are certified by professional organizations such as the Associated Locksmiths of America (ALOA) or the International Association of Automotive Locksmiths (IAAL).
- Insurance coverage: Ensure the locksmith is guaranteed to cover any unintentional damages that might take place throughout the service.
- Customer Reviews: Positive reviews and testimonials can provide you self-confidence in the locksmith's capabilities and client service.
- Response Time: A locksmith who can get here rapidly is important, particularly in emergencies.
- Series of Services: Choose a locksmith who can handle various concerns, from easy lockouts to complex key programming.
Typical Car Locksmith Services
Here are some of the most common services offered by car locksmith professionals:
- Car Lockout Service: This is the most asked for service, where the locksmith helps you unlock your car when you are locked out.
- Key Duplication: If you need an extra key, a locksmith can replicate your existing key quickly and accurately.
- Key Programming: Modern cars and trucks frequently need key programming, which involves establishing the car's computer system to recognize a new key.
- Ignition Repair: If your ignition is harmed, a locksmith can repair or replace it.
- Transponder Key Services: Transponder keys consist of a chip that interacts with the car's immobilizer system. An expert locksmith can program or replace these keys.
- Car Lock Installation and Repair: Whether you require to set up a new lock or repair a damaged one, a locksmith can assist.

FAQs About Car Locksmiths
Q: How much does a car locksmith usually cost?A: The expense can vary depending upon the service and the locksmith. Typically, a car lockout service might cost in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150, while key duplication can vary from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50. Key programming can be more pricey, usually in between ₤ 70 and ₤ 200.
Q: Can an inexpensive locksmith service compromise the security of my car?A: Not always. Lots of budget-friendly locksmith professionals are extremely knowledgeable and use the latest tools and techniques to guarantee your car's security. Nevertheless, it's crucial to confirm their qualifications and read consumer reviews to ensure they are respectable.
Q: How can I discover a 24/7 car locksmith?A: Use online search engines and local directory sites to find locksmiths who provide 24/7 services. You can likewise ask for suggestions from pals or local organizations.
Q: Is it legal to utilize a locksmith for my car?A: Yes, it is legal to utilize a locksmith for car-related services. Nevertheless, the locksmith should validate your identity and ownership of the vehicle to abide by legal requirements.
Q: Can a locksmith assist with modern automobiles that have electronic locks?A: Yes, many expert locksmiths are trained to manage modern-day cars and trucks with electronic locks and transponder keys. They can program and replace these keys as needed.
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ys and don't have a spare?A: Contact a reliable car locksmith who can make a brand-new key for you. They may require to validate your ownership of the vehicle, so have your registration or other documentation ready.
